Abstract: A vacuum generator is provided wherein the intake vacuum of a combustion engine is led to a negative pressure device such as a vacuum booster of a brake booster device through a check valve. An idling air passage is connected to a suction pipe of the combustion engine to bypass a throttle valve arranged in the suction pipe. An ejector is arranged in the idling air passage at the downstream of an idle speed control valve in serial relation to the same, and the intake for idling is performed through the ejector. As the intake air flow passing through the idling air passage increases, the intake negative pressure which is generated at a vacuum takeout port of the ejector is further increased in absolute value, whereby the negative pressure device has a negative pressure which is further increased in absolute value.

Abstract: An aircraft tire, the inflation pressure of which is greater than 12 bar, comprises a crown, two sidewalls and two beads, a carcass reinforcement anchored in the two beads and a crown reinforcement. The carcass reinforcement comprises at least two circumferential alignments of first reinforcing threads of high elasticity modulus. The means for anchoring the first reinforcing threads within each bead comprises second reinforcing threads oriented circumferentially and axially bordering the circumferential alignments of the first reinforcing threads, the first reinforcing threads and second reinforcing threads being separated by a layer of mix of very high elasticity modulus.

Abstract: What is proposed here is a method of structuring surfaces of glass-type materials and variants of this method, comprising the following steps of operation: providing a semiconductor substrate, structuring, with the formation of recesses, of at least one surface of the semiconductor substrate, providing a substrate of glass-type material, joining the semiconductor substrate to the glass-type substrate, with a structured surface of the semiconductor substrate being joined to a surface of the glass-type substrate in an at least partly overlapping relationship, and heating the substrates so bonded by annealing in a way so as to induce an inflow of the glass-type material into the recesses of the structured surface of the semiconductor substrate. The variants of the method are particularly well suitable for the manufacture of micro-optical lenses and micro-mechanical components such as micro-relays or micro-valves.

Abstract: In an encoder signal interpolation divider (1) that automatically corrects errors in the offset and gain of an input signal at a high speed with a low cost circuit configuration, and can accurately generate an encoder signal having a predetermined resolution by interpolation division, analog input signals (A1, B1) are subjected to offset correction by a 0-point correction circuit (13) in adders (4, 5) prior to being digitally converted by A/D converters (8, 9), and are subjected to gain correction by an amplitude correction circuit (14) in amplifiers (6, 7). The corrected analog signals are converted to digital values, angle data is calculated in an angle data lookup table (10), and, based on these results, an encoder pulse signal having a predetermined resolution is generated and output from an encoder pulse signal generating circuit (12).
Abstract: A capacitive pressure sensor and its manufacturing method can simplify the alignment and the bonding process in a vacuum, and stably carry out the bonding process. The capacitive pressure sensor includes an insulating, first substrate with a capacitance electrode, a second substrate which has a diaphragm electrode so as to separate a vacuum chamber and a pressure-measuring chamber on respective surfaces, and an insulating, third substrate with a gas inlet. The substrates are bonded in a manner that the capacitance electrode faces the diaphragm electrode and the pressure-measuring chamber leads to the gas inlet. In addition, a getter chamber is formed in the same surface of the second substrate as the pressure-measuring chamber, and the getter chamber is connected to the vacuum chamber.

Abstract: A track pin bushing for cooperating with a track pin in an endless track has a tubular body with a metallurgically bonded wear-resistant coating and a method for forming such a coated track pin bushing is taught herein. The tubular body, formed of an iron-based alloy, has an outer surface that is carburized and quenched, i.e., case-hardened, in at least a section thereof. At least a portion of the case hardened section has been removed to a depth sufficient to expose a non-carburized layer of the iron-based alloy. A hard metal alloy slurry is disposed on the non-carburized layer and forms a metallurgical bond between the non-carburized layer and the coated unfused slurry by fusing the hard metal alloy. The thickness of the unfused slurry is adjusted to be from 1.67 to 2.0 times a final thickness of the wear-resistant coating. The wear-resistant coating comprises a fused, metal alloy comprising at least 60% iron, cobalt, nickel, or alloys thereof.
